Perth Airport is Australia’s Western Hub connecting the people, businesses and communities of Western Australia with the rest of Australia and the world. Operating 24 hours a day, seven days a week throughout the year, Perth Airport plays a significant role in providing economic, social and cultural benefits to West Australians.

Perth Airport is investing more than $5 billion in new infrastructure so we can support our airline partners to grow, offering more services to new destinations and an improved customer experience.

Over the coming decade we will expand T1 International, and build new domestic terminal facilities, a parallel runway, two multi-storey carparks and our first airport hotel. This will deliver one airport for the people of Western Australia which will host all flight services in a central location giving passengers a seamless, world-class travel experience.

The Perth Airport estate is spread over 2100 hectares and has developed a $1.5 billion portfolio of existing industrial premises and significant vacant land holdings.

We service a truly diverse community and play an important role in strengthening cultural, family and social bonds while supporting business, tourism and leisure travel.

We are currently looking for an experienced and enthusiastic Senior Contracts Administrator to join the New Terminal team.

What you'll do:

As a Senior Contracts Administrator, you’ll be a key player in delivering Perth Airport’s New Terminal project. You’ll oversee the full lifecycle of construction and consultancy contracts—ensuring everything from procurement planning to financial reporting runs like clockwork.

Your day will involve negotiating contract terms, managing claims and variations, and keeping a close eye on budgets and performance metrics. You’ll work hand-in-hand with internal teams and external partners to ensure compliance, resolve issues, and maintain strong commercial outcomes.

Whether it’s reviewing tenders, supporting cost control measures, or guiding stakeholders through contract processes, your work will help shape the success of one of Perth Airport’s most exciting infrastructure developments.

About you:

You’re a confident and commercially savvy professional who enjoys bringing structure and clarity to complex projects. You’ll likely bring:

·A qualification in quantity surveying, construction management, or construction law, with hands-on experience in contract administration.

·A solid background in managing consultancy and construction contracts, ideally within large-scale infrastructure or capital works.

·Strong negotiation skills and the ability to navigate claims, variations, and contract terms with confidence and tact.

·A deep understanding of procurement models, financial risk, and cost control strategies.

·Sharp attention to detail and the ability to juggle multiple contracts and deadlines without compromising quality.

·A collaborative mindset, with a knack for building trusted relationships across teams and with external partners.

·Clear and professional communication skills—you know how to make complex contract language easy to understand.

·A proactive, solutions-focused approach, always ready to tackle challenges and drive outcomes.
